  • Emirates to fly daily to Houston

  • Emirates airline has announced that it will offer daily flights to Houston beginning Feb. 1, reported Gulf News. The airling had recently announced three-days-a-week service to the American city, and it popular among both business and leisure travelers, according to Gaith Al Gaith, Emirates executive vice-president for commercial operations worldwide. Shippers in the oil and gas industry account for over 70% of the service's cargo. The operation is currently handling about 16 tonnes of cargo out of Houston and about 10 tonnes into the American gateway.

  • BDF buys Avro jet

  • Bahrain Defence Force (BDF) has bought an Avro RJ100 regional jet from BAE Systems Regional Aircraft to bring its fleet of the type to three aircraft, reported Gulf Daily News. The aircraft is currently being operated by Finnish carrier Blue 1. It will join the two RJ85s currently operated.

  • British Airways to expand in ME

  • British Airways is planning further expansion of its operations in the Middle East and Asia to offset slower growth in North America, which has traditionally been its mainstay, reported Gulf News. The Middle East remains one of the fastest growing sectors in the aviation world. As corporate business growth out of the UK into the Middle East has reached double figures in recent years. As a result, the airline has increased its Club World seats on its Boeing 747 flights from 38 to 55.

  • RAK airport expansion underway

  • The airport at Ras Al Khaimah is undergoing a regeneration programme to increase the number of annual passengers and planes it can handle every year. The emirate's airport can currently cope with one million passengers a year and this will be increased by 500,000, Michelle Soliman CEO of RAK Airport told delegates at the MEED Ras Al Khaimah conference.

  • Qatar Airways to fly to Guangzhou

  • Qatar Airways has announced plans to serve the southern Chinese industrial port city of Guangzhou beginning March 31, becoming the first airline from the Gulf to serve Guangzhou. It will operate four flights-a-week non-stop using an Airbus A330 aircraft in a two-class configuration. The addition of Guangzhou strengthens the carriers China network, where it already flies to Beijing, Shanghai and Hong Kong with a total of 16 flights a week.

  • Sama launches frequent flyer program

  • Sama, the newest low-fares airline in Saudi Arabia, has launched a frequent flyer program that provides one free trip for every nine trips that a passenger makes on the airline. The Frequent Traveller Program is the first rewards program among low-fares airlines in the Middle East.
